QUALIFICATION of having passed the NON-FORMAL TRAINING that accredits the Units of Competence included in the Training Module MF1926_1 Basic tasks in the assembly of tubular scaffolding, regulated in Royal Decree 986/2013, of December 13, which establishes the Certificate of Professionalism EOCJ0109 Assembly of Tubular Scaffolds. In accordance with the Instruction of March 22, 2022, which determines the admission criteria for the training provided by persons requesting participation in the evaluation and accreditation procedure of professional skills acquired through work experience or non-formal training routes. Description

In the field of building and civil works, it is necessary to know the different fields in the assembly of tubular scaffolding, within the professional area of ​​placement and assembly. Thus, this course aims to provide the necessary knowledge for basic tasks in the assembly of tubular scaffolding.

Job opportunities

Production area, mostly as a salaried worker in small, medium and large private companies under the direction and supervision of a manager, and where appropriate organizing the work of his team of operators. Collaborates in the prevention of risks in its area of ​​responsibility, being able to perform the basic function of preventing occupational risks.

What does it prepare you for?

This training is in accordance with the training itinerary of the Training Module MF1926_1 Basic tasks in the assembly of tubular scaffolding, certifying having passed the different Units of Competence included in it, and is aimed at the accreditation of the Professional Competencies acquired through work experience and non-formal training, through which you will be eligible to obtain the corresponding Certificate of Professionalism, through the respective calls published by the different Autonomous Communities. as well as the Ministry of Labor itself (Royal Decree 659/2023, of July 18, which develops the organization of the Vocational Training System and establishes a permanent procedure for the accreditation of professional skills acquired through work experience or non-formal training).

Who is it addressed to?

This course is aimed at professionals in the world of building and civil works, more specifically in the assembly of tubular scaffolding, and all those interested in acquiring knowledge related to assembling and disassembling tubular scaffolding.

Objectives

- Differentiate the different types of scaffolding and structures assembled with tubular scaffolding elements, identifying its elements and parts, and relating their functions. - Describe the auxiliary tasks and works that make up the assembly, disassembly and maintenance of tubular scaffolding, identifying the different phases and activities to be carried out and specifying work methods. - Identify the health and safety conditions necessary to carry out the basic assembly operations of tubular scaffolding, interpreting specific instructions received in application of the assembly/use/disassembly plans and technical instructions from tubular scaffolding manufacturers. - Manipulate and transport loads as well as forming stockpiles, selecting the necessary equipment and complying with the instructions received regarding work methods and health and safety conditions. - Develop supply, lifting and placement or removal activities of parts during the assembly and disassembly phases, or for their maintenance, complying with the instructions received regarding work methods and health and safety conditions, coordinating with the members of the work team. - Develop activities to finish tubular scaffolding for maintenance and disassembly, complying with the instructions received regarding work methods and health and safety conditions, coordinating with the members of the work team.
